Puj Tub
Before little Beckley was born, a friend recommended the baby Puj Tub to us. So, Beckley's first bath and everyone since was in the Puj Tub (see pictures below). Although he was upset during his first bath, he now loves bath time in the Puj Tub!
Th Puj Tub is basically a flat piece of soft white styrofoamy material. It has magnetic closures which keep it in the shape to cradle a baby and be placed in a sink. There are also holes in the sides and front of the tub that allow the water to run out. So, I basically but the tub in our sink then turn on the faucet to fill the tub up.


This tub has worked great for us... and Beckley. Beckley is our first child, so we were a bit apprehensive about the whole bath thing. He was also only 5 pounds when we brought him home from the hospital, which added to the apprehension. The Puj Tub has been perfect! I love that I can keep the water running in the sink and still control the water level by adjusting the tubs position in the sink. It is also a soft surface which seems perfect for a newborn. The Puj Tub can be unfolded and becomes flat-- which is great for storage (especially for us as we are jam packed in a 1 bedroom apartment), I hung a hook in our shower and just hang the Puj Tub to dry after each use (the tub comes with a hole to hang it by). We also took the Puj Tub on Beckley's first road trip this past weekend-- when unfolded it took very little space.

The Puj Tub is all I have ever used to bath an infant, but I love it! (and so does Beckley!) He is now almost 9 pounds and it is still working perfectly. I would totally recommend the Puj Tub to friends and family!
